What is Orchestration?
Orchestration refers to the coordination and management of multiple IT tasks, processes, or services across various systems and applications. The primary goal of orchestration is to automate and optimize workflows, ensuring that tasks are executed in the correct sequence and work together harmoniously to achieve a larger, more complex objective. Whether it’s managing IT systems, applications, or services, orchestration simplifies and streamlines operations to enhance efficiency and minimize the need for human intervention.

Orchestration vs. Automation
While automation and orchestration are often used interchangeably, they are distinct concepts. Automation refers to the execution of individual tasks without human involvement, such as automatically filling out forms or processing data. Orchestration, on the other hand, is the process of coordinating and combining multiple automated tasks into an integrated workflow, where each task triggers the next in a logical sequence to complete a larger process. Orchestration is essentially the “master” control system that ensures all automated tasks work together seamlessly.
Why is Orchestration Necessary?
In modern IT environments, businesses operate across a mix of cloud, on-premises, and hybrid systems. Managing these systems individually can become complex and inefficient. Orchestration addresses this complexity by integrating and automating various tasks across these systems. This ensures that processes are not only automated but also well-coordinated, making it easier to scale operations and manage workloads.
For example, provisioning a new server typically involves multiple tasks, such as creating a virtual machine, configuring the network, applying security settings, and updating the IT management system. Orchestration ensures that these steps are completed in the correct order and with the right dependencies, eliminating manual intervention and reducing errors.
Key Types of Orchestration
Application Orchestration
Application orchestration involves integrating and automating the processes between two or more applications. This integration ensures that data flows seamlessly between systems, enhancing the efficiency of application development and operation. It is crucial for scaling operations, particularly when dealing with large volumes of data or complex business processes.
Cloud Orchestration
As businesses migrate to the cloud, cloud orchestration tools are used to manage, automate, and optimize cloud resources. This involves automating processes like provisioning servers, allocating storage, and managing networking resources across public, private, or hybrid clouds. Cloud orchestration ensures that resources are used efficiently, reducing waste and lowering operational costs.
Security Orchestration
Security orchestration involves automating and coordinating security tools and processes to protect an organization’s IT environment. By streamlining tasks such as threat detection, incident response, and vulnerability management, security orchestration enhances the speed and effectiveness of security operations, thereby reducing the risk of breaches and minimizing the impact of cyber threats.
Container Orchestration
Container orchestration is the automation of container management tasks, including deployment, scaling, and networking. This is particularly useful for managing containerized applications, which are becoming increasingly popular in cloud-native environments. Tools like Kubernetes and Docker Swarm are widely used for orchestrating containers, ensuring they are efficiently deployed and scaled according to demand.
How Orchestration Works
Orchestration tools connect various systems, applications, and services to create a cohesive workflow. For example, in a cloud deployment, orchestration tools might first provision the necessary server resources, then configure the operating system, and finally deploy an application. The orchestration tool ensures that each step happens in the correct order and that dependencies between tasks are managed effectively. By automating these processes and eliminating the need for manual oversight, orchestration enables IT teams to concentrate on more strategic tasks.
